Temperature Needs of Hazel
Optimal Temperature Range ๐ก๏ธ
Hazelnuts thrive best in a temperature range of 15ยฐC to 25ยฐC (59ยฐF to 77ยฐF). Maintaining this range is crucial for healthy growth and optimal nut production.
Different hazelnut varieties have unique temperature needs. The European hazel flourishes in moderate climates, while the American hazel shows a bit more resilience to temperature fluctuations.
Temperature Thresholds for Growth and Dormancy โ๏ธ
For proper dormancy, hazels require chilling temperatures below 7ยฐC (45ยฐF) during winter. Insufficient chilling can negatively impact flowering and nut set, leading to disappointing yields.
When temperatures drop below 15ยฐC (59ยฐF), growth rates can stall significantly. This cessation of growth can hinder the overall health of the plant.
Signs of Temperature Stress ๐ฅ
Heat stress manifests through wilting leaves, leaf scorch, and a noticeable reduction in nut yield. Conversely, cold stress can lead to leaf drop, stunted growth, and even dieback of branches.
Visual indicators of temperature stress include changes in leaf color and texture. These signs can help you identify when your hazels are struggling.
Causes of Temperature Stress โ ๏ธ
Extreme heat is a major concern, especially when temperatures exceed 30ยฐC (86ยฐF) for extended periods. Additionally, frost events can be damaging, particularly when temperatures dip below -5ยฐC (23ยฐF) during critical growth stages.
Rapid temperature fluctuations can also induce stress in hazels. Sudden changes can disrupt their growth patterns and overall health.
Impact of Climate Change ๐
Climate change is shifting average temperatures, which may alter optimal growth conditions for hazels. Warmer winters can affect chilling requirements, impacting dormancy and flowering.
Moreover, the increased frequency of extreme weather events poses significant challenges for hazel cultivation. Understanding these changes is vital for adapting cultivation practices to ensure healthy hazelnut production.
